[1] : The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48
vermicelli \ver`micel"li\, n. it., pl. of vermicello,
   literally, a little worm, dim. of verme a worm, l. vermis.
   see worm, and cf. vermicule, vermeil.
   the flour of a hard and small-grained wheat made into dough,
   and forced through small cylinders or pipes till it takes a
   slender, wormlike form, whence the italian name. when the
   paste is made in larger tubes, it is called macaroni.
   1913 webster

[2] : WordNet (r) 2.0
vermicelli
     n : pasta in strings thinner than spaghetti
